xptool 发表于 2008-11-12 02:57:38

如何同时打开多个链接(我重新表达一下)

如果循环打开记事本中的多个链接如何设置呀 不用输密码 输入用户名 点登陆即可

记事本有多个连接 每个连接是个网站 每个网站是个注册页 有一个输入框 可以输入用户名 然后提交如果有几百个网站   怎样设置下时间

[ 本帖最后由 xptool 于 2008-11-15 05:33 编辑 ]

sanhen 发表于 2008-11-12 03:17:27

有些提问,我总是看不明白。

rho123 发表于 2008-11-12 14:34:19

#include <IE.au3>

$file = FileOpen ("123.txt",0);按行循环读取文本
    If $file <> -1 Then
      While 1
         $line_txt = FileReadLine($file)
         If @error = -1 Then ExitLoop
                        if $line_txt <> "" Then
                        _IECreate($line_txt,0,1,0,-1)   
                        EndIf
               Wend
    EndIf
FileClose($file)       

123.TXT
一行一个连接,小子 连接多了小心死机

xptool 发表于 2008-11-14 13:45:31

感谢HRO123

记事本有多个连接 每个连接是个网站 每个网站是个注册页 有一个输入框 可以输入用户名 然后提交如果有几百个网站   怎样设置下时间

xptool 发表于 2008-11-14 23:26:10

网页都是这样的http://www.8euromail.nl/pages/confirm.php

输入邮箱

点下面按钮提交

网页显示确认
有 200多个这样的链接

我想每个2秒注册一个链接都在同路径的记事本里 AUTOIT如何实现

真会走路的废柴 发表于 2008-11-15 08:40:19

代码给出

#include <IE.au3>
#include <File.au3>
$Mail = "xxxx@xxx.com";这里改成你的邮箱地址
$List = @ScriptDir&"\列表.txt" ;这个是网址的那个路径,文本文件里面 一行一个.
$Line = _FileCountLines($List)
$oIE = _IECreate()
For $i = 1 To $Line
        $Url = FileReadLine($List,$i)
        _IENavigate($oIE,$Url)
        $oUser = _IEGetObjByName($oIE,"userform")
        _IEFormElementSetValue($oUser,$Mail)
        $oSubmit = _IEGetObjByName($oIE,"submit")
        _IEAction($oSubmit,"click")
Next
页: [1]
查看完整版本: 如何同时打开多个链接(我重新表达一下)